What is the expected accuracy of the position (x, y, z) for the positional tracking functionality of the ZED cameras? i.e. +- (0.01, 0.1, 0.1) in meters for x,y,z

For the accuracy of the positional tracking for the ZED cameras i.e. +- (0.01, 0.1, 0.1) in meters for x, y, z-axis, the accuracy depends on the scene you are looking at (since the ZED camera is a stereovision camera).


Using the ZED SDK, we also provide you with the possibility to ingest IMU data into our tracking algorithms.

To give you more information that might be helpful, we have given on our website the average accuracy in normal/good conditions (light, texture, etc.) : 

Motion: 6-axis Pose Accuracy
Position: +/- 1mm
Orientation: 0.1°
Frequency: Up to 100Hz
Technology: Real-time depth-based visual odometry and SLAM
